2006 Mustang GT Spark Plug Socket Size Guide

    2006 Mustang GT Spark Plug Socket Size

    Overview

    If you own a 2006 Mustang GT and need to replace the spark plugs, it’s important to know the correct socket size to use. Using the wrong size socket can lead to damage to the spark plugs or the socket itself. In this article, we will provide you with the spark plug socket size for the 2006 Mustang GT.

    Spark Plug Socket Size Chart

    To make it easier for you to find the right socket size, here is a chart that lists the spark plug socket size for the 2006 Mustang GT:

    Engine Type Socket Size
    4.6L V8 5/8 inch (16mm)

    Steps to Replace Spark Plugs

    If you’re planning to replace the spark plugs in your 2006 Mustang GT, here are the steps you can follow:

    1. Make sure the engine is cool before starting any work.
    2. Locate the spark plug wires on top of the engine.
    3. Remove the spark plug wire from the first spark plug by firmly pulling it straight off.
    4. Using the appropriate spark plug socket size (5/8 inch or 16mm), attach it to a ratchet or extension.
    5. Place the socket over the spark plug and turn it counterclockwise to loosen and remove the old spark plug.
    6. Inspect the spark plug for any signs of damage or wear. If necessary, replace it with a new one of the same type and gap.
    7. Apply a small amount of anti-seize compound to the threads of the new spark plug.
    8. Insert the new spark plug into the socket and carefully thread it into the spark plug hole by hand.
    9. Tighten the spark plug using the socket and ratchet, turning it clockwise until it is snug.
    10. Reattach the spark plug wire to the spark plug by pushing it firmly onto the terminal.
    11. Repeat the above steps for each spark plug, one at a time.
